In an era of unusual collaborations, Gucci and The North Face have teamed up to release a line of refined outdoor gear.

Gucci first teased the unlikely union via the ever-popular TikTok and Instagram. In a series of three short, nature-filled videos, viewers were made aware of the upcoming collection with a shot of a flapping flag featuring a fusion of the brands’ respective logos.

Sadly, the only information we have at time of writing is that the collaboration is actually in the works – details are still under wraps. According to Forbes, a Gucci rep confirmed over email, “We can only confirm that Gucci and the North Face will be bringing a collection to life in the coming months that celebrates the rich heritage of both brands!”

The North Face is no stranger to collaborations: in 2020, the brand has joined forces with MM6 Maison Margiela, Supreme, Junya Watanabe, and Brain Dead.

Gucci’s collaboration with the longtime outdoor brand is particularly relevant in our pandemic era, when a collective craving to reconnect to nature and the outdoors has never been stronger.
